BIT-tomcat-2020-11996
No affected components available
A specially crafted sequence of HTTP/2 requests sent to Apache Tomcat 10.0.0 to 10.0.0, 9.0.0 to 9.0.35 and 8.5.0 to 8.5.55 could trigger high CPU usage for several seconds. If a sufficient number of such requests were made on concurrent HTTP/2 connections, the server could become unresponsive.
